Khani Chak - Thakurgangti, Godda

Khani Chak is a village situated in the Thakurgangti subdivision of Godda district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 10 km from the tehsil headquarters in Thakurgangti and around 75 km from the district headquarters in Godda. Kharkhodia serves as the Gram Panchayat for Khani Chak village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khani Chak is 355863. The village covers a total geographical area of 53.5 hectares and falls under the 814133 pincode.

Khani Chak village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Khani Chak

As per Census 2011, Khani Chak village has a total population of 681 people, consisting of 364 males and 317 females. The village has 143 households and a sex ratio of 870 females per 1,000 males. There are 147 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 328 literate and 353 illiterate residents. Additionally, 17 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Khani Chak

Public transport in the Khani Chak is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Ammapalli Halt,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 60.1 km.
